Best hit
| Source | Best Hit ID | Description | E-value |
|---|---|---|---|
| TAIR | AT5G46570.1 | BR-signaling kinase 2. Encodes BR-signaling kinase 2 (BSK2), one of the three homologous BR-signaling kinases (BSK1, AT4G35230; BSK2, AT5G46570; BSK3, AT4G00710). Mediates signal transduction from receptor kinase BRI1 by functioning as the substrate of BRI1. Plasma membrane localized. | 0 |
